Как изменить язык интерфейса в приложении

Как поменять язык в приложении

Как поменять язык в приложении

Язык интерфейса напрямую влияет на понимание элементов меню, настроек и системных сообщений. В большинстве приложений смена языка выполняется через встроенные параметры, но в ряде случаев используется язык операционной системы или данные профиля пользователя. Ошибочный выбор может привести к недоступности нужных пунктов или некорректному отображению текста.

На мобильных устройствах Android и iOS логика работы с языками различается. Одни приложения поддерживают отдельный выбор языка внутри себя, другие автоматически подстраиваются под региональные настройки системы. В веб-приложениях язык часто хранится в учетной записи и применяется при входе с любого устройства.

В статье разобраны практические сценарии: где искать переключатель языка, как действовать, если нужного варианта нет в списке, и что делать при сбросе настроек после обновления. Отдельное внимание уделено ситуациям, когда интерфейс меняется только после перезапуска или очистки кэша.

Материал подходит пользователям, которые столкнулись с непонятным языком интерфейса, а также тем, кто настраивает приложение для работы в многоязычной среде. Все рекомендации основаны на типовых механизмах, применяемых в современных мобильных и веб-приложениях.

Где в настройках приложения находится выбор языка

Где в настройках приложения находится выбор языка

Параметр языка чаще всего размещён в разделе настроек, доступ к которому открывается через меню приложения или экран профиля. На уровне интерфейса это пункты с названиями Язык, Язык интерфейса или Регион. В большинстве случаев список языков отображается сразу после перехода в раздел без дополнительных экранов.

В мобильных приложениях настройка языка обычно находится не на первом уровне. Типовой путь: меню → настройки → блок, связанный с внешним видом или пользовательскими параметрами. Если приложение поддерживает поиск по настройкам, ввод слова язык позволяет быстро перейти к нужному пункту.

В веб-приложениях выбор языка чаще привязан к учетной записи. Он располагается в настройках профиля, выпадающем меню пользователя или в нижней части интерфейса. Изменение применяется к текущей сессии и сохраняется для последующих входов.

Если в настройках отсутствует пункт языка, интерфейс формируется на основе системных параметров устройства или языка браузера. В таком случае переключение выполняется вне приложения, а изменения становятся заметны после обновления страницы или повторного запуска.

В корпоративных сервисах параметр языка может быть недоступен обычным пользователям. Его размещают в административных настройках, где язык задается для всей команды или проекта.

Изменение языка через системные параметры устройства

Изменение языка через системные параметры устройства

Многие приложения не имеют собственного переключателя языка и используют значение, заданное в операционной системе. В этом случае язык интерфейса определяется при запуске на основе системных параметров и не хранится в настройках самого приложения.

На устройствах Android язык задается в разделе системных настроек, связанном с языком и регионом. После выбора нового языка система предлагает применить его ко всем приложениям. Интерфейс изменяется после перезапуска приложения, иногда требуется полное закрытие из списка запущенных.

В iOS язык можно задать как для всей системы, так и для отдельного приложения. В настройках устройства выбирается нужное приложение, затем указывается язык интерфейса. Этот вариант удобен, если требуется оставить общий язык системы без изменений.

В настольных системах Windows и macOS приложения ориентируются на язык системы или учетной записи пользователя. Изменение выполняется через параметры языка и региона, после чего приложение необходимо перезапустить, а в отдельных случаях – выйти из учетной записи.

Если после смены системного языка интерфейс приложения не изменился, следует проверить поддержку выбранного языка. При его отсутствии приложение загружается на языке по умолчанию, независимо от системных настроек.

Смена языка без перезапуска приложения

Смена языка без перезапуска приложения

Некоторые приложения позволяют изменить язык интерфейса мгновенно, без выхода и повторного запуска. Для этого разработчики реализуют динамическое обновление текста в текущей сессии.

Чтобы использовать эту функцию, действуйте по следующей схеме:

  • Откройте настройки приложения и перейдите в раздел Язык или Интерфейс.
  • Выберите нужный язык из списка доступных.
  • Нажмите кнопку Применить или аналогичную, если она присутствует.
  • Следите за индикаторами обновления: в большинстве приложений меню и подписи меняются сразу.

В веб-приложениях динамическая смена языка может работать через перезагрузку отдельных компонентов страницы. Для этого:

  1. Выберите язык в настройках профиля или панели пользователя.
  2. Система автоматически подгружает текстовые ресурсы для выбранного языка.
  3. Изменение применяется к текущему сеансу без выхода из аккаунта.

Если после смены языка часть элементов осталась на старом языке, проверьте кэш приложения и обновите страницу или вкладку. В мобильных приложениях иногда требуется прокрутить экран или открыть новое окно, чтобы новые строки отобразились корректно.

Что делать если нужный язык отсутствует в списке

Что делать если нужный язык отсутствует в списке

Если нужный язык не отображается в настройках, сначала проверьте версию приложения. Некоторые языки доступны только в последних обновлениях. Обновление через официальный магазин приложений может добавить недостающий вариант.

В мобильных приложениях и веб-сервисах также имеет смысл проверить системные параметры устройства. Приложение может использовать язык операционной системы, и добавление нужного языка в список системных языков позволит выбрать его в интерфейсе.

Если язык все еще отсутствует, можно:

  • Использовать альтернативный язык, максимально близкий к нужному по терминологии.
  • Обратиться к поддержке приложения с запросом на добавление языка или инструкции по ручной локализации.
  • В некоторых случаях можно использовать сторонние расширения или плагины, которые подменяют языковые файлы приложения.

Для корпоративных решений доступ к языкам часто ограничен администратором. В этом случае необходимо согласовать добавление нового языка через административную панель или команду поддержки.

Как вернуть язык интерфейса по умолчанию

Возврат языка интерфейса по умолчанию требуется, если выбранный язык некорректно отображается или вызывает ошибки. В большинстве приложений настройка выполняется через меню параметров.

Алгоритм действий:

  1. Откройте настройки приложения и перейдите в раздел Язык или Интерфейс.
  2. Выберите пункт По умолчанию или Системный язык, если такой доступен.
  3. Сохраните изменения и перезапустите приложение при необходимости.

В мобильных приложениях иногда требуется очистить кэш или выйти из профиля, чтобы изменения вступили в силу.

В веб-приложениях возврат к языку по умолчанию часто выполняется через настройки профиля или кнопку Сброс в разделе Язык. После этого интерфейс автоматически применяет язык, заданный при установке приложения или системе.

Если опция возврата недоступна, язык определяется системными параметрами устройства. Для этого:

  • На Android проверьте Настройки → Система → Язык и ввод.
  • На iOS перейдите в Настройки → Основные → Язык и регион.
  • В Windows и macOS язык возвращается через системные параметры и учетную запись пользователя.

Изменение языка в веб приложении через профиль пользователя

Изменение языка в веб приложении через профиль пользователя

В большинстве веб-приложений язык интерфейса определяется настройками учетной записи. Для его изменения необходимо войти в профиль и открыть раздел Настройки или Профиль, где размещён список доступных языков.

Алгоритм действий:

  1. Войдите в учетную запись на веб-платформе.
  2. Перейдите в раздел Профиль или Настройки.
  3. Найдите блок Язык интерфейса или Language.
  4. Выберите нужный язык из списка доступных и подтвердите выбор.
  5. Если требуется, обновите страницу для применения изменений ко всем компонентам интерфейса.

Некоторые веб-приложения сохраняют выбор языка в браузере через cookie или локальное хранилище. В таких случаях смена устройства или браузера потребует повторного выбора языка в профиле.

Если выбранный язык не отображается корректно, проверьте поддержку локализации в текущей версии приложения и убедитесь, что язык включён в учетной записи.

Особенности смены языка в мобильных приложениях Android

Особенности смены языка в мобильных приложениях Android

В Android язык интерфейса приложения может определяться системными настройками или задаваться отдельно внутри приложения. Если приложение использует системный язык, его изменение выполняется через Настройки → Система → Языки и ввод → Языки. Новый язык применяется ко всем поддерживаемым приложениям после перезапуска.

Для приложений с внутренним выбором языка последовательность действий следующая:

  • Откройте меню приложения и перейдите в Настройки или Профиль.
  • Найдите раздел Язык или Интерфейс.
  • Выберите нужный язык и подтвердите изменения. В современных версиях интерфейс обновляется без закрытия приложения.

Если часть элементов остаётся на старом языке, рекомендуется очистить кэш приложения через Настройки → Приложения → [Имя приложения] → Память → Очистить кэш и полностью перезапустить его.

Региональные настройки системы влияют на отображение форматов даты, времени и некоторых текстов. При смене языка внутри приложения эти параметры могут оставаться прежними, если не синхронизированы с системными настройками.

Особенности смены языка в приложениях на iOS

Особенности смены языка в приложениях на iOS

В iOS приложения могут использовать язык системы или иметь собственные настройки языка. Для системных приложений смена языка выполняется через Настройки → Основные → Язык и регион. Изменения применяются ко всем поддерживаемым приложениям после перезапуска.

Для приложений с внутренним выбором языка алгоритм следующий:

Действие Описание
Открыть настройки приложения Перейдите в меню приложения и выберите Настройки или Профиль.
Найти раздел языка Ищите блок Язык или Интерфейс, иногда он размещается в разделе Общие или Параметры отображения.
Выбрать язык Отметьте нужный язык из списка и подтвердите выбор. В современных приложениях изменения вступают в силу сразу.
Перезапуск при необходимости Если интерфейс частично остаётся на старом языке, полностью закройте приложение и откройте его снова.

Некоторые приложения учитывают региональные настройки iOS для отображения форматов даты, времени и валюты. При смене языка внутри приложения эти параметры могут не изменяться, если остаются привязанными к системной локали.

Вопрос-ответ:

Как изменить язык интерфейса, если приложение не имеет отдельного переключателя?

Если в приложении нет встроенной настройки языка, интерфейс использует язык операционной системы. На Android это делается через Настройки → Система → Языки и ввод → Языки, на iOS через Настройки → Основные → Язык и регион. После смены языка приложение нужно перезапустить, чтобы изменения применились.

Почему после смены языка часть элементов остаётся на старом языке?

Некоторые приложения используют кэшированные текстовые ресурсы или зависят от региональных настроек. Чтобы исправить это, очистите кэш приложения через системные параметры и полностью закройте приложение. В веб-приложениях иногда требуется обновить страницу или очистить локальное хранилище браузера.

Можно ли сменить язык в веб-приложении без выхода из аккаунта?

Да, большинство современных веб-приложений позволяет выбрать язык через настройки профиля. После выбора новый язык применяется к текущему сеансу. Иногда требуется обновить страницу, чтобы изменения вступили в силу для всех компонентов интерфейса.

Что делать, если нужного языка нет в списке доступных?

Сначала убедитесь, что установлена последняя версия приложения, так как новые языки часто добавляются в обновлениях. Если язык отсутствует, можно использовать ближайший по терминологии вариант или обратиться в службу поддержки. В некоторых случаях для добавления языка требуется согласование с администратором в корпоративных приложениях.

Как вернуть язык интерфейса к настройкам по умолчанию?

В настройках большинства приложений есть пункт По умолчанию или Системный язык. Для возврата необходимо выбрать этот вариант и сохранить изменения. В мобильных приложениях иногда требуется очистить кэш и перезапустить приложение, чтобы интерфейс полностью обновился.

Как изменить язык интерфейса в приложении на смартфоне, если нужный язык не отображается в настройках?

Если нужный язык отсутствует в списке настроек приложения, сначала проверьте, использует ли приложение системные параметры. На Android это Настройки → Система → Языки и ввод → Языки, на iOS — Настройки → Основные → Язык и регион. Добавьте нужный язык в список системных и перезапустите приложение. Если язык не появился, убедитесь, что установлена последняя версия приложения. В некоторых случаях приложение ограничивает выбор языка, и для добавления нового требуется обратиться в поддержку или использовать ближайший по терминологии вариант.

Ссылка на основную публикацию